Configure working hours
Manage Working Hours console shows the working hours or shifts that can be worked upon in the organization. The working hours record holds the number of hours that can be worked, in a week.
To access to this console log in to the Portfolio Management application, click Settings and click Resource Management > Allocation > Working Hours. It is accessible by the Resource Master and the Agility Admin users.
To create Working Hours Configuration
- Log in Portfolio Management application and click Settings .
- Go to Resource Management > Allocation > Working Hours.
- Click on the '
New' button to create a new Working Hours record.
Field | Description | Example |
---|---|---|
Summary | Add the summary of the working hours record. | UK Working Hours: 40h - 5 days*8 hours |
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, Saturday, Sunday | Add the number of hours for every weekday. | Monday: 8, |
Status | The status field has two options namely, Active and Inactive. The default status after the creation of a working hours record is "Active". To remove the usage of an already configured working hour record, change the status to "Inactive". This will disallow the creation of new allocated working hours records for that working hours record. |
Note: The Working Hours record that is already in use on an Allocated Working Hours record cannot be edited. To avoid its further usage its status must be set to 'Inactive'.
To Modify Working Hours
- Log in Portfolio Management application and click Settings .
- Go to Resource Management > Allocation > Working Hours.
- Click on the display id of the working hours record or select the row and click on the Edit (
) button.
- Make the necessary modifications.
- Click on Save.
To Delete Working Hours
- Log in Portfolio Management application and click Settings .
- Go to Resource Management > Allocation > Working Hours.
- Select the row and click on the Delete (
) button.
Note that only those Working Hours records can be deleted that are not already used in Allocated Working Hours.
